Bredenbeck's Bakery & Ice Cream Parlor, established in 1889, serves hand-dipped cones, sundaes and milkshakes made with Ha gen Dazs, Bassett s ice cream and Dannon frozen soft-serve yogurt. The ice cream parlor, located in Philadelphia, is also popular for its handmade butter cookies, dessert miniatures and special occasion tortes. Founded by Frederick Robert Bredenbeck, the ice cream parlor specializes in wedding cakes, brownies, cupcakes, Bailey's Irish Cream cheesecakes and Shamrock Petits Fours. While visiting the ice cream parlor's Web site, customers can download recipes, browse and purchase products, place personal delivery and corporate gift orders. In addition, the ice cream parlor s wholesale division sells its baked goods to country clubs, restaurants, corporations and institutions.
